对象存储 速度,深入解析对象存储速度计算方法及其影响因素
- 综合资讯
- 2024-10-27 03:16:30
- 2

摘要:本文深入解析对象存储速度计算方法,包括读取、写入、访问速度的计算,并分析影响对象存储速度的关键因素,如网络带宽、存储节点性能、数据格式等,为优化对象存储性能提供理...
摘要:本文深入解析对象存储速度计算方法,包括读取、写入、访问速度的计算,并分析影响对象存储速度的关键因素,如网络带宽、存储节点性能、数据格式等,为优化对象存储性能提供理论依据。
随着大数据、云计算等技术的飞速发展,对象存储作为一种新型存储技术,得到了越来越多的关注,对象存储以其高效、安全、便捷等特点,成为数据存储领域的重要解决方案,在实际应用中,如何准确计算对象存储速度成为了一个关键问题,本文将从对象存储速度的定义、计算方法以及影响因素等方面进行深入解析。
对象存储速度的定义
对象存储速度通常指的是对象存储系统在单位时间内处理数据的能力,即读写速度,可以包括以下三个方面:
1、读取速度:指对象存储系统在单位时间内从存储设备中读取数据的速率。
2、写入速度:指对象存储系统在单位时间内向存储设备写入数据的速率。
3、吞吐量:指对象存储系统在单位时间内处理数据的总量,包括读取、写入操作。
对象存储速度的计算方法
1、实验法
实验法是评估对象存储速度最直接、最准确的方法,通过搭建测试环境,模拟实际应用场景,对对象存储系统进行读写操作,并记录所需时间,具体步骤如下:
(1)搭建测试环境:选择合适的对象存储系统,配置服务器、存储设备等硬件资源。
(2)设置测试数据:准备一定量的测试数据,包括文件大小、类型等。
(3)进行读写操作:分别对测试数据进行读取和写入操作,记录所需时间。
(4)计算速度:根据测试数据量和操作时间,计算读取速度、写入速度和吞吐量。
2、模拟法
模拟法通过模拟实际应用场景,预测对象存储速度,具体步骤如下:
(1)收集数据:收集目标对象存储系统的性能参数,如CPU、内存、存储设备等。
(2)建立模型:根据收集到的数据,建立对象存储系统性能模型。
(3)预测速度:通过模型预测对象存储系统的读取速度、写入速度和吞吐量。
3、厂商提供的数据
部分对象存储厂商会在产品宣传中提供其产品的速度数据,这些数据可以作为参考,但需注意以下几点:
(1)厂商提供的数据可能与实际应用场景存在差异。
(2)数据可能经过优化处理,存在一定的误差。
影响对象存储速度的因素
1、硬件设备
(1)存储设备:存储设备的性能直接影响对象存储速度,如SSD比HDD具有更高的读写速度。
(2)网络设备:网络设备的带宽、延迟等因素会影响数据传输速度。
2、软件优化
(1)文件系统:不同的文件系统对存储速度的影响不同,如NFS、CIFS等。
(2)协议:不同的存储协议对速度的影响也不同,如HTTP、FTP等。
3、数据分布
(1)数据存储位置:数据存储位置越接近客户端,速度越快。
(2)数据副本:数据副本越多,读写速度越快,但会增加存储成本。
4、系统负载
(1)并发用户:系统并发用户越多,速度越慢。
(2)读写操作:读写操作越多,速度越慢。
对象存储速度是衡量其性能的重要指标,通过本文对对象存储速度的定义、计算方法以及影响因素的解析,有助于用户更好地了解对象存储速度,为实际应用提供参考,在实际应用中,需综合考虑硬件设备、软件优化、数据分布和系统负载等因素,以获得最佳的性能表现。
本文链接:https://www.zhitaoyun.cn/358247.html
发表评论